What Is Ready-Mix Concrete?

Ready-Mix Concrete (RMC) is a type of concrete that is prepared at a batching plant using the right mix of cement, sand, aggregates, water, and admixtures. It is then delivered to the construction site in a ready-to-use form through transit mixer trucks.

Unlike site-mixed concrete, RMC offershigh quality, saves time, and reduces human errors during mixing.

How to Use Ready-Mix Concrete Effectively

Here are some expert tips to help youuse ready-mix concrete the right wayfor maximum speed and safety:

1. Plan Ahead and Choose the Right Mix

Start by understanding your project needs:

  • What is the purpose? (Slab, column, beam, etc.)

  • What grade of concrete is needed? (e.g., M20, M25)

  • What slump value is required?

Share these details with your supplier to get the perfect mix that suits your structure.

2. Prepare the Site Before Delivery

Ensure your site is ready for pouring:

  • Formwork and steel reinforcement should be completed

  • All tools and labor must be on standby

  • Access routes for the transit mixer should be clear

A prepared site ensuresquick and smooth placement, saving valuable time.

3. Use the Concrete Within Time

Ready-mix concrete must be used within 90120 minutes after mixing. Delays can affect the strength and quality of the concrete.

So, always:

  • Schedule delivery wisely

  • Ensure immediate pouring once the truck arrives

4.Ensure Safe Access for the Transit Mixer

Check the site layout to ensure the concrete truck can reach the pouring area. If the spot is hard to access:

  • Use a concrete pump

  • Use wheelbarrows or buckets for short distances

Safe movement of equipment and materials reduces accidents on site.

5. Do Not Add Water at the Site

Many people add water to make the concrete flow easilybut thats a mistake!

Adding water:

  • Weakens the concrete

  • Affects its strength and durability

If the slump is low, inform the supplier in advance so they can adjust the mix with approved admixtures.

6.Use Skilled Labor for Placement

Even though RMC reduces manual work, skilled workers are still needed for:

  • Pouring

  • Compaction

  • Leveling

  • Finishing

Proper handling ensures strong, crack-free structures and improves construction safety.

7. Use Concrete Pumps for Speed and Safety

In large or multi-storey projects, concrete pumps are the best way to transport concrete quickly and safely.

They:

  • Reduce labor effort

  • Minimize handling risks

  • Speed up the pouring process

8.Follow All Safety Guidelines on Site

Using RMC still requires attention to safety:

  • Workers should wear helmets, gloves, and boots

  • Ensure safe paths for truck movement

  • Avoid standing near the truck chute during pouring

Following safety practices reduces accidents and injuries.

9. Check the Quality on Arrival

When the RMC truck arrives:

  • Check the delivery slip for grade and quantity

  • Verify slump value if needed

  • Take a sample cube for testing if required

This ensures you are getting the right mix for your structure.

10.Cure the Concrete Properly

After pouring, curing is key to gaining full strength. Start curing:

  • After initial setting (68 hours)

  • Continue for at least 7 to 14 days

  • Use water, wet coverings, or curing compounds

Proper curing ensures durability and crack resistance.

FAQs

1. Can Ready-mix Concrete Be Used in Small Construction Projects?

Yes, RMC is suitable for both small residential and large commercial projects.

2. How Long Can I Store Ready-mix Concrete?
You cannot store RMC. It must be used within 90 to 120 minutes of mixing.

3. Is RMC Stronger Than Site-mix Concrete?
Yes, RMC offers better strength and durability due to precise mixing under controlled conditions.

4. Do I Need Special Tools to Use Ready-mix Concrete?
Not necessarily. But for large or high-rise projects, concrete pumps and vibrators may be needed.

5. What Should I Do if the Concrete is Too dry on Arrival?
Do not add water yourself. Inform the supplier and request a revised mix in future deliveries.
